From Gauze Street, Paisley to Easterhouse by train
To get from Gauze Street, Paisley to Easterhouse in Glasgow, take the SCOTRAIL train from Paisley Gilmour Street station to Glasgow Central station. Next, take the SCOTRAIL train from Glasgow Queen Street station to Easterhouse station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 4 min.
